Backup archive shrink

Post by tony200 »

hi,

I have a backup from my notebook to a 500gb USB disk, the backup disk has 50Gb free disk space ...
I can't run the job ... error "no free disk space"

can I shrink the backup archive with 1 full and 2 incremential points manually to 1 full without running the job over gui ... may be by a script?

so I get more free space and I can run the job normally over the gui.

thanks a lot.

Re: Backup archive shrink

Post by Mildur »

Hi Tony,

If you don’t have space for a new incremental backup you’ll need to manually delete the entire backup chain, and start from scratch. My suggestion is to get a bigger disk; 500GB is really low these days.

I recommend using our calculator to estimate backup space. Make sure your backup disk has enough free space for additional 1-2 full backups just in case.
